    This is a small lounge on the Priority Pass. I went while waiting for my late afternoon flight. The attendants were very courteous though they were not really on the floor all the time. Food options were not mind-blowing but ok. Buffet style. There was a Mediterranean Chicken braised dish available when I went. Some soup and the salad bar rounded out vegetarian options. I had cheese and chocolate mousse, as well as what I considered to be a great perk of this lounge-- vegetarian cup ramen! I also got the complementary white wine out of the several complementary alcohol options. They do have a full bar available for a fee, but I was already on my second wine of the day, so I did not need more. The bathrooms were spacious and I saw signs for a shower, though I didn't check as I was just waiting for my flight. I did want to print something and had come specifically because I heard they had a printer, but the computer was not working and no one was around for me to ask about it. My gold standard for airport lounges will always be the Sapphire at LGA, but this was quite a nice option.

    Went lounge hopping with my priority pass and stopped by Air France lounge, Turkish lounge and primeclass. Air France near gate 1 has the widest variety for food and dessert, Turkish lounge by gate 2-3 is good to grab some small water bottles to go (right by Air France lounge gate) and primeclass by gate 8/9 has ramen/instant noodles plus largest restroom space that's great if you have a luggage/carry on/bag with you! They also have really yummy cheesecake! Pretty empty on Sunday from noon to 3pm when I'm flying out.

    Small-ish lounge with lots of food, snack and drink options. Came here around 330PM on a weekday (Wednesday) and there was a waitlist. It said it'd be about a 30 min wait which turned out to be pretty accurate (got in around 25 min). There's hot food (pasta, veggie, chicken) and lot of cold food options (salad, fruit, cheese, dessert). Also had variety of bread and snacks. Even had instant ramen! There's a bartender that has complimentary wine/beer as well as other liquor/cocktails for purchase.

    There are a few Priority Pass lounges in Terminal 1 that you can choose from. We picked this one because the pictures looked the best and it had the best reviews. It was just okay. We stopped in at around 8 on a Thursday night and it wasn't full but I can see it getting crowded during busier hours. The food is very lackluster. There's a salad bar that has some pasta salad, veggies, cheeses, and some hot food. On this day, they had pasta, chicken, spring vegetables, and rice pilaf but all looked like they came from a frozen dinner. Good thing we brought our own food because none of it looked appetizing. They also had tomato basil soup, and broccoli cheddar, which was mediocre. The water from the filter tasted a bit off so we ended up just buying bottled water. Wish we stopped by a different lounge instead but as I always say, any lounge is better than no lounge.
